CENS Deployment Center

Abstract

CENS collects data for scientific applications using nascent embedded sensing system technology on real-world deployments. Data collection occurs through a complex set of interactions and relationships between people, instruments, and the physical setting. In order to fully understand and evaluate data that results from real-world deployments, it is necessary to be aware of the context of data collection. CENS deployment documentation varies widely, existing both electronically and in lab or field notebooks, and is typically stored separate from the data. We are developing the CENS Deployment Center, a web accessible database for deployment information to provide CENS research groups with a centralized location for pre-deployment planning and post-deployment knowledge. We hope that the CENSDC will promote deployment efficiency and continuity as research personnel changes over time and CENS technology is deployed more widely.
